Is Reckless Driving a Criminal Offense in Virginia? Yes,   reckless driving is a criminal offense in Va . It's a traffic violation and a Class 1 misdemeanor, meaning a conviction can result in penalties beyond fines. Penalties may include license suspension, increased insurance costs, and possibly prison time.
